DBE National Pairs Championship 2019 Report

DBE National Pairs Championship – 2019

This years DBE National Pairs Championship was held at Royal Leamington Spa on Saturday 13th July.  Bowlers from across the country turned out to compete in this knock out National Ranking competition.  Players who lose in the first round are entered into a Plate competition, guaranteeing every bowler 2 matches.

Each match was played over 15 ends or first to 21 with respot if the jack is killed.  DBE were honoured by Steve Glasson, Head Coach for Bowls Australia agreeing to present the prizes in conjunction with our Mo Monkton.

Plate Competition

Colin Wagstaff & Daniel Adams contested the final against Tim Swann & Lee Whiteley.  This was a nip and tuck afair with both pairs not giving an inch right up to the last end when the score was levelled at 16 all.  An extra end was played, Colin & Daniel took the vital shot to win the plate.

DBE National Pairs Championship

Played at a very high standard the final went down to the wire with a shock at the end!  18 shots shared over 15 ends demonstrates the competitiveness of this match.  Like the Plate final an extra end was played.  With only two bowls left to be played, Jonathan & Mike held shot with a bowl 14 inches behind the jack, Chris played his last wood and trailled the jack to hold two shots.  Mike had the last bowl of the competition……he fired……the jack shot out of the rink, killed.  Respot.  One of Chris Grays bowls was nearest the respot giving him and Stephen the Championship.  Brilliant end to an excellent Championship.
